Hello.
I am an owner of a Phillips TiVo HDR212. My TiVo cannot make its daily calls (it made one daily call about three weeks ago and has not made one since). It usually logs on for between 7 and 15 minutes and then I get a "Call Interrupted" message.
I am located in New York City and I use the following settings.
Prefix: ,#034 Call Waiting: *99
I also have a DSL Filter on the Line. I have turned off Call Waiting on Vonage.com and have set the "Bandwith Saver" to 90Kbps.
I have considered calling Vonage tech support but I don't know what to ask them!
Any suggestions would be very much appreciated!

The HDR212 is a Series 1 model. You should try a prefix of ,#019 instead of ,#034.
If you call Vonage, just tell them you are trying to get your TiVo to work. Call them from a non-Vonage line, if you can, so that you can test while you are on the phone with them. |
